I am sure the problem is on my end but one of you experts will answer it quickly I hope:

 

My directional gyro is not moving at all. What do I have to turn on to make it work? Yesterday I just turned on everything but this thing still doesn't move. The UGR compass works but is a little small to read.

The one above, small tape like display, has a button down left which needs to be in the position that the red dot in the gauge disappears. Then it is free rotating with a direction change. Otherwise - red dot on - it is blocked and manually adjustable to actual heading.
